Changes in the properties of the vector mesons in hot and dense hadronic ma
tter, as produced in heavy-ion collisions, lead to the intriguing possibili
ty of the opening of the decay channel omega-->rho pi, for the omega meson,
which is impossible in free space. This along with the channel omega pi-->
pi pi would result in a decrease in its effective lifetime enabling it to d
ecay within the hot zone and act as a chronometer in contradiction to the c
ommonly held opinion and would have implications vis a vis determination of
the size of the region through pion interferometry. A new peak and a radic
ally altered shape of the low invariant mass dilepton spectra appears due t
o different shifts in the masses of rho and omega mesons. The Walecka model
is used for the underlying calculation for the sake of illustration. [S055
